Fitness Class Descriptions
Abs & Core/Muscle Toning & Core
Develop your core stability and overall muscle strength, with emphasis on proper body mechanics and exercise execution. This is a strength-based class, concentrating on various back and abdominal exercises, and does not include a cardio component.
Beginner Weights
This instructional class involves hands on learning in the gym. It is intended to provide information to those who have little or no experience using free weights and machines. Participants learn the basic principles of resistance training and attain a level of comfort working out in all sections of the gym.

Fusion
Join us for an invigorating combination of the disciplines of yoga, Pilates and fitness, providing deep muscle work, with stretching and relaxation. Taught by a licensed physiotherapist, this class emphasizes proper body alignment and balanced strength. A variety of equipment will be used, including the Bender Ball and Styrofoam roll.
Hatha Yoga
Learn how to perform basic yoga poses from a certified and experienced instructor. The focus is on adapting proper form, injury prevention and the release of stress and negativity through therapeutic breathing techniques. This class is friendly and welcoming; you will feel supported through your yoga journey. No previous yoga experience required.
